NATURAL CONVECTION IN A SQUARE CAVITY WITH LOCALIZED HEATING FROM BELOW

The natural convection with discrete heat sources at the bottom wall in a square cavity is investigated using a finite volume based computational procedure. A square cavity with discrete heat flux at the bottom wall is analyzed with top and the left walls are adiabatic while the right wall is maintained at a constant temperature. The analysis is carriedout for a range of Raleigh's number 10~3 to 10~7. The cases are also examined with 25% opening at the right cold wall. Nusselt number increases monotonically with increase of Rayleigh number. The effect of opening at the right cold wall does not have significant effect on the heat transfer.
